Performance Under Pressure: The Ratchet Mechanism
The integrated ratchet device is the heart of this tool's reliability. It prevents the jaws from opening until a full crimp cycle is completed. No half-assed jobs here.
This 'reset device' also allows for adjustment of crimping pressure, a feature often overlooked in cheaper models. Different terminal materials and wire types sometimes require slight variations in pressure. Fine-tuning ensures optimal results every time. It's about control.
Generic crimpers often leave you guessing if the crimp is sufficient. The HS-30J's positive feedback mechanism, indicated by the release of the ratchet, provides undeniable confirmation. This eliminates the need for visual inspection or pull tests on every single crimp, saving valuable time and ensuring safety.

Application Versatility: Wire Gauges and Terminal Types
The HS-30J is specified for a crimping range of 0.5-6mm² (AWG 22-10). This covers a broad spectrum of common electrical wiring applications. From automotive to household circuits, it handles a lot.
The tool is specifically designed for insulated terminals and nylon terminals, as explicitly stated in the product imagery. This specialization means it's optimized for these specific terminal types, providing superior results compared to general-purpose crimpers. It does one job, and it does it well.
Many entry-level crimpers struggle with the varying insulation thicknesses of different terminals. The HS-30J's design, with its adjustable pressure and dedicated dies, ensures a consistent, secure crimp regardless of the terminal's specific construction within its specified range. This means fewer re-dos and more reliable connections.
Maintenance and Longevity: Keeping it Running
Regular inspection of the jaws for wear or damage is crucial. A damaged jaw will produce faulty crimps. Keep it clean.
The 'setscrew' feature, used to fix the jaws and release them for replacement, indicates a modular design. This means if the dies ever wear out or if different crimping profiles are needed, they can be swapped. This extends the tool's lifespan significantly. It's a smart design choice.
Unlike tools that require complete replacement when a single component fails, the HS-30J's replaceable jaws offer a cost-effective solution for long-term use.
